Best Knox County Public Preschools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 7 public preschools serving 2,002 students in Knox County, OH.
The top-ranked public preschools in Knox County, OH are East Elementary School, Dan Emmett Elementary School and Wiggin Street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Knox County, OH public preschools have an average math proficiency score of 73% (versus the Ohio public pre school average of 52%), and reading proficiency score of 75% (versus the 53% statewide average). Pre schools in Knox County have an average ranking of 9/10, which is in the top 20% of Ohio public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public preschool average of 39% (majority Black).
